This was the most difficult period experienced by many as there was uncertainty of job, business and health issues. The lockdown shut all work and the migrant workers had nowhere to go as no job, no salary and no shops open for food. Trains & public transport was halted and hence there was no choice but to leave their city of work. India saw the largest migration of workers and families within the country. Harrowing experience for many, long walks to their village back home. Large numbers of NGO were helping the needy but that was not enough. Government trying to bring sense of discipline but it didn’t work. Chaos prevailed.

The India’s workforce initially did Work From Home (WFH) but as the lockdowns extended many industries, corporate, hospitality units were forced to shut shop thereby laying off  employees. Bad times for employed & self employed, shopkeepers, travel trade, hotels-resort-restaurants, construction trade, industries.....in short all except IT industry (WFH), Large corporate /Banks (WFH wherever possible continued while some were laid off), medical & pharma industry, Food & Dairies, Hospitals, clinics. The picture was grim with people’s bank balance dwindling and some already bankrupt. The speed of disaster...68 days!  

The government had geared up and medical facilities (Covid centers) were being erected, permission to start new testing labs were given and were being opened at frantic speed, doctors and other medical staff worked 24/7, police were on toes all the time without rest and these were the segments that were working to Save India, selflessly. Salutations to them !!

I will not go into details of government efforts at all levels but yes some states were doing good while some struggled. Lack of facilities due to large number of patients was the problem. By the end of 31st May’20 the patients were 1.82lakhs plus form 500 on 24th March2020.
